Social Views on Gambling
Gambling at casinos is seen variously across cultures, with each community imbuing its own beliefs and beliefs into the activity. In some North American cultures, casinos are viewed as a hub of entertainment and leisure, a place to socialize and enjoy excitement. The vibrant atmosphere, filled with lights and sounds, offers a form of escapism that many find attractive. People gather not only to gamble but also to celebrate special occasions and forge social bonds.
Contrarily, in other cultures, gambling can be viewed with skepticism or disapproval. In certain Asian societies, for instance, the practice of gambling is often associated with negative consequences, such as addiction and financial ruin. Here, traditional values may promote caution and restraint, leading to a more cautious approach towards gaming. Such viewpoints can influence local laws and the manner in which casinos function, shaping how gaming activities are incorporated into the society.
